🍽️ Southern Comfort Food at Its Best

For a taste of classic Southern cuisine, head to one of these restaurants:

1. Wholly Smokin’ BBQ and Ribs

Serving up some of the best BBQ in Florence, this family-owned restaurant has been a local favorite for over a decade. Their ribs are fall-off-the-bone delicious, and their brisket is melt-in-your-mouth perfection. Don’t forget to try their famous mac and cheese!

2. Red Bone Alley

Known for their creative twists on Southern favorites, Red Bone Alley is a must-visit for foodies. From their famous shrimp and grits to their homemade pimento cheese, every dish is a culinary masterpiece. And don’t forget to try their famous Key lime pie for dessert!

🍜 International Cuisine to Satisfy Your Cravings

If you’re in the mood for something a little more exotic, these restaurants will transport your taste buds around the world:

3. Thai House

Located in downtown Florence, Thai House serves up authentic Thai cuisine that will make you feel like you’re in Bangkok. From their spicy curries to their savory pad Thai, every dish is bursting with flavor. And don’t forget to try their mango sticky rice for dessert!

4. Efird’s Mediterranean

If you’re in the mood for Mediterranean fare, Efird’s is the place to go. Their hummus is creamy and delicious, and their gyros are packed with flavor. And don’t forget to try their baklava for dessert!

πŸ₯˜ More Delicious Dining Options in Florence

Looking for something a little different? Here are a few more restaurants worth checking out:

5. Town Hall

Located in historic downtown Florence, Town Hall is a popular spot for date night or a night out with friends. Their eclectic menu features everything from steak to sushi, and their craft cocktails are a must-try.

6. Tubb’s Shrimp and Fish Co.

If you’re in the mood for seafood, Tubb’s is the place to go. Their fried shrimp is crispy and delicious, and their hushpuppies are the perfect accompaniment. And don’t forget to try their fried banana pudding for dessert!

7. The Library

For a unique dining experience, head to The Library. This upscale restaurant is located in an old library building, and their menu features everything from steak to seafood to pasta. And don’t forget to check out their extensive wine list!

8. Victors

Victors is one of the signature restaurants in Florence, SC. This restaurant gives a fine dining experience with their delicious dishes and fine atmosphere.

9. Giuseppe’s Italian Restaurant

For authentic Italian cuisine, Giuseppe’s is the place to go. From their homemade pasta to their wood-fired pizzas, every dish is made with love and care. And don’t forget to try their tiramisu for dessert!
